[English translation: BRISINGHAMEN]

[Lyrics: Grutle Kjellson]

In solitude she cries, the most beautiful of them all

Captured and locked in a sorrow no one can conceive

Joy vanished far out there

Burning desire, but no hope

She longs for home, bu tcan not find a way

A dismal destiny hidden behind a smile

Mardol, you glorious, sacrificed for peace you were

You sold your flesh, but found no comfort

That which glitters does not bring you peace

Gern you devoted yourself

and consumed many desire.

But, still in the night,

gold is dripping from your eyes.

Fråya, Od you shall find when everything ends

Then you shall be set free

Untill that day you shall find no comfort

Not even in the shining Brisinghamen

[music: R. Kronheim & Ivar Bjèrnson]
